About the role
Provide massage services to guests using props and/or products. Provide body treatments to guests using body scrubs, wraps, and/or hydrotherapy.
Responsibilities
- Assess guest needs and inquire about contraindications (e.g., allergies, high blood pressure, and pregnancy) before beginning service
- Keep up to date with current techniques and modalities related to their field of work
- Escort guests to and from treatment rooms
- Arrange workstation, treatment room, and/or drapes
- Frequently check with guest to promote comfort, safety and security throughout service
- Promote and sell spa/salon services including retail offerings related to the Spa
- Clean, maintain, and sterilize tools
- Maintain cleanliness of workstation and/or treatment room throughout shift, dispose of trash and dirty linens, and secure supplies and equipment at the end of each shift
- Monitor and stick to time schedule throughout the day
- Handle inappropriate guest behavior by following Marriott International standard operating procedures for Inappropriate conduct for guests and therapists, leading up to and including stopping a treatment or service and informing supervisor/manager
- Maintain current skills and licensure in service area as per regional requirements
- Report accidents, injuries, and unsafe work conditions to manager; complete safety training and certifications
